I give you Six Weird Things About Me:

  1. I sucked my thumb until the ripe old age of 10. But after age 5 or so, the thumb usually wound up in my mouth while I slept. It became an involuntary thing. “What got you to quit, Catheroo?” Slumber parties. I would have been mortified had one of my early-rising friends seen me in my thumb-sucking glory. I started putting a Band-Aid on my thumb if I was going to spend the night at a friend’s. The non thumb-like taste and texture of the adhesive bandage was disgusting and I’d immediately pull my thumb out of my mouth on contact. The trick worked at home too, so eventually I quit my embarrassing habit.
  2. I have had a black eye three times. And each time it was due to my own stupidity. The first one was when I slammed my face into the fax machine at Price Waterhouse. I was bending down to pick up something I dropped, and THWACK! Smacked my right eye with the corner of the output tray. Black eye number two happened while opening a bottle of champagne. I was just starting to twist the cork when someone suggested I grab a towel to cover the bottle, lest the cork go flying. As I reached into the drawer to get the towel, BAM! Cork, meet face. Face, cork. The third (and hopefully last) time I practiced accidental self-abuse was at my friend Krissy’s bachelorette party. I was in the bathroom at some club and after using the facilities, I bent down to pick up my purse from the floor. Apparently my vision was impaired because my face made contact with a shelf in the stall. That shelf? It was specifically for holding purses. As I recall, most of my faculties were not operating at their fullest potential that evening.
  3. I have an irrational fear that my apartment will catch fire. One of my neighbors will be irresponsible and leave a candle burning. My heater will blow up. Someone will toss out a lit cigarette butt and the lovely trees around my place will quickly be engulfed in flames and we’ll all burn to a crisp. Perhaps I am Smokey the Bear, reincarnated.
  4. I am thoroughly intimidated when I shop at M.A.C. for makeup. It takes me back to high school. I feel like I don’t belong. I don’t have enough makeup smeared onto my face, my clothes aren’t designer enough, and I’m as unpopular as a band/drama geek (sorry to all you band/drama geeks). It’s as if the employees are going to talk about me after I leave. “Did you see that girl? Oh. My. God. I mean, jeans and Vans? Can you believe that? She should stick to buying her cosmetics from the grocery store.” Never mind the fact that I just gave them one hundred of my hard-earned dollars.
  5. Sometimes I laugh so hard, a little pee comes out. Sometimes it’s more than a little.
  6. I wanted Sonny and Cher to be my parents. They had a TV show and my parents did not. I could not understand why that was, despite the numerous explanations from Mom and Dad. One night, we were having pizza for dinner and I didn’t want any. Mom told me that’s what we were having, so I was to deal with it. I retorted, “I’ll bet Chastity (Bono) doesn’t have to eat pizza if she doesn’t want to!” Then I packed some things, grabbed my trike and left home forever to live with my new parents, Sonny & Cher. I got as far as the corner (as Mom and Dad watched from the window, unbeknownst to me) and turned right around. I wasn’t allowed to cross the street without an adult holding my hand. Even out on my own, I still followed the rules. P.S. When Sonny died a few years back, I was much sadder than I should have been.
